Abstract

Although Middle East has many complicated problems the most important problem is absolutely the Palestine-Israel conflict. The Palestinian-Israeli conflict is directly or indirectly affecting other problems in the region. Hamas is one of the important actors in the region. As clearly stated in the HAMAS Pact published in August 1988, the ideological structure and organization of the organization is based on the Muslim Brotherhood established in Egypt. The emergence of the Palestinian Muslim Brotherhood as a separate party under the name of HAMAS came to the fore with the Intifada, which began in 1987. The organization which has ended the Al-Fatah dominance in Gaza is both having harsh criticism and praise both in world and Turkey. Like the other Middle East organizations HAMAS is a very well organized group. HAMAS has shifted to a more realistic line in time. In fact, the indirect support given by international actors to Israel's oppressive and violent policies has pushed Palestinians into violence. Also contrary to the common thought HAMAS is standing at a moderate and reasonable point at the moment compared to past.
